💻Xteink X3 E-Ink Display Supports Custom Firmware and Printing

Programmable e-ink display with custom firmware and printing support

TL;DR

The Xteink X3 e-ink display is fully programmable with CrossPoint firmware, allowing for custom features and printing via IPP. It supports Apple raster and PWG raster formats, with 2,550 × 3,300 pixel display capacity.

The Xteink X3 is a programmable e-ink display device that supports custom firmware, enabling users to add features like boot animations. It uses IPP for printing, accepting monochrome output at 300 dpi. The device has a 2,550 × 3,300 pixel display and supports Apple raster and PWG raster formats. This opens up possibilities for developers looking to integrate e-ink displays into their projects. The device has 400 KB of RAM, with 6.8 KB left after running Wi-Fi and the printer server, making it a compact yet capable solution.
